Description -
24-bit, Crystal Semiconductor® analog-to-digital converter and 24-bit, 192 kHz Analog Devices® digital-to-analog converters
32-bit, 20 Mhz control processor
24-bit, 150 MIPS Motorola Sympony™ DSP processor
Dolby Digital EX, Dolby Pro Logic IIx, DTS ES and DTS NEO: 6 decoding modes
Support for all digital sampling rates to 96 Khz
Digital Domain treble and bass control as well as bass management function
DSP “simulated” surround mode for enhancement of two-channel source
Direct two-channel analog bypass mode
Gold-plated input and output connectors and balanced XLR outputs and unbalanced RCA outputs
Six A/V inputs, each with audio, S-video and composite video with three A/V outputs, each with audio, S-video and composite video
Eight-channel analog input with separate RCA connectors for DVD-audio format
Three component video inputs and two component video outputs
Automatic video transcoding: up converts composite and s-video sources to component video
Six coaxial and four digital inputs and coaxial and optical digital outputs, including from analogue and down-mixed 5.1 sources
AM/FM tuner with 40 presets
Three audio only inputs including MM phono stage
Two tape outputs
Record outputs feature down-mixed two-channel output from a 5.1 digital source
Four sub-woofer output connectors
7.1 channel outputs plus stereo side outputs for a total of 9.1 channels
Party mode for two-channel playback through all speakers
Zone Two can play sources independent of the main zone
Trigger outputs for both zones
IR control of both zones with rear IR ports and discrete codes
RS-232 control port with discrete codes
Flash memory upgradable through RS-232 port
